Transaction 90e3cab661cb8627f23ab21b1df6af3b8a48170f2c23a6194a34e02d36216061
1 Input
1 Output
-
90e3cab661cb8627f23ab21b1df6af3b8a48170f2c23a6194a34e02d36216061:0
- value
- 5027504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1d25fab9c1a143b8b587d39e7981990d004901f OP_EQUAL
- address
- 3PjenoAFU7dpPKth8RCd7sWABw5V7sLQDz